Here are resources available in **Indiana** for **Child Abuse Help**: --- ### **1. Indiana Child Abuse and Neglect Hotline** - **Phone**: **1-800-800-5556** (24/7) - **Website**: [Indiana DCS Child Abuse Reporting](https://www.in.gov/dcs/child-protection/child-abuse-hotline/) - **Services**: - Report suspected child abuse or neglect anonymously. - Operates 24/7 to connect individuals with child protection services. - Offers guidance on recognizing and reporting abuse. --- ### **2. Indiana Department of Child Services (DCS)** - **Website**: [Indiana Department of Child Services](https://www.in.gov/dcs/) - **Services**: - Protects children from abuse and neglect through investigations and interventions. - Provides foster care and adoption resources. - Assistance for families in need of support to prevent child abuse. --- ### **3. Prevent Child Abuse Indiana** - **Website**: [Prevent Child Abuse Indiana](https://pcain.org/) - **Phone**: **317-775-6500** - **Services**: - Educational programs on preventing child abuse. - Resources for families, caregivers, and communities. - Advocacy to strengthen policies protecting children. --- ### **4. National Child Abuse Hotline** - **Phone**: **1-800-4-A-CHILD (1-800-422-4453)** - **Website**: [ChildHelp.org](https://www.childhelp.org/) - **Services**: - Free, confidential, 24/7 support for victims of child abuse. - Connects individuals to resources in Indiana. - Bilingual counselors available. --- ### **5. CASA (Court-Appointed Special Advocates) for Children** - **Website**: [Indiana CASA Network](https://www.indianacasa.org/) - **Services**: - Advocates for children involved in abuse and neglect cases. - Works with courts to ensure children’s safety and well-being. - Support for children in foster care or juvenile systems. --- ### **6. Indiana 211** - **Phone**: **Dial 211** - **Website**: [Indiana 211](https://www.in211.org/) - **Services**: - Connects individuals to local services for child abuse support. - Assistance for families seeking counseling or crisis intervention. --- ### **7. Riley Children’s Health - Child Protection Program** - **Website**: [Riley Child Protection Program](https://www.rileychildrens.org/) - **Location**: Indianapolis, IN - **Services**: - Medical evaluations for suspected child abuse cases. - Collaboration with law enforcement and child protection agencies. - Comprehensive care for abused children. --- ### **8. Kids’ Voice of Indiana** - **Website**: [Kids' Voice of Indiana](https://www.kidsvoicein.org/) - **Phone**: **317-558-2870** - **Services**: - Legal services and advocacy for children in abuse cases. - Educational programs on child safety and abuse prevention. - Guardianship assistance for children in need. --- ### **9. National Center for Missing and Exploited Children (NCMEC)** - **Phone**: **1-800-THE-LOST (1-800-843-5678)** - **Website**: [MissingKids.org](https://www.missingkids.org/) - **Services**: - Assistance in cases of child exploitation or trafficking. - Reporting mechanism for suspected online abuse. - Support for families dealing with abuse-related trauma. --- ### **10. Local Law Enforcement and Emergency Services** - **Phone**: **911** for immediate danger. - Contact your local police department or sheriff’s office for urgent intervention in abuse cases. --- ### **11. Indiana Youth Institute (IYI)** - **Website**: [Indiana Youth Institute](https://www.iyi.org/) - **Services**: - Data, training, and resources for professionals working with abused or neglected children. - Advocacy for child well-being across Indiana communities. --- ### **12. Child Advocacy Centers in Indiana** - **Website**: [Indiana Chapter of the National Children's Alliance](https://incacs.org/) - **Services**: - Multidisciplinary support for children and families affected by abuse. - Forensic interviews, medical exams, and counseling services. --- ### **13. Family and Social Services Administration (FSSA)** - **Website**: [Indiana FSSA](https://www.in.gov/fssa/) - **Services**: - Resources for families to prevent neglect or abuse. - Financial assistance and parenting support programs. --- Preventing and addressing child abuse requires strong community support and action.
